Transaction 43447946794644c46b8f500557cefbbfe8619d56223738f712f51958a4af3a5d
1 Input
1 Output
-
43447946794644c46b8f500557cefbbfe8619d56223738f712f51958a4af3a5d:0
- value
- 332611
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 242a5c52c8451bd13054c52053bcc71b7e71878c OP_EQUAL
- address
- 34zEzicubdfemWsBnUiKLQbenhEanbtUUi